Optimization of enrichment conditions of lauric acid in coconut oil by urea adduction fractionation method

Abstract:
      The urea adduction fractionation method was used to enrich lauric acid in coconut oil. Coconut oil was used as raw material to prepare coconut oil mixed fatty acid by saponification and acid hydrolysis, and then the lauric acid was enriched by urea adduction fractionation from mixed fatty acid. Through single factor experiment and orthogonal experiment optimization, the order of the six factors affecting the embedding effect from high to low was obtained as follows: water bath temperature, embedding time, mass ratio of urea to mixed fatty acid, water bath time, mass ratio of urea to methanol and embedding temperature. The optimal enrichment conditions of lauric acid in coconut oil by urea adduction fractionation method were obtained as follows: mass ratio of urea to methanol 1∶?2, water bath temperature 50?℃, embedding time 10 h, mass ratio of urea to mixed fatty acid 1∶?1.5, water bath time 5 h and embedding temperature -20?℃. Under these conditions, the content of lauric acid after enrichment was 60.05%, increasing by 9.35 percentage points compared with 50.70% of that before enrichment.
